Output ba6fb3b8d31aae242b3811221437ed6d780c0c05f643675cf3ebe097d786b998:0

value
218696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1218d9ce42047968b130878b037146107de3678b OP_EQUAL
address
33LhrfHBQmUzFDXTmZfkDDewqo4Q3aNuHc
transaction
ba6fb3b8d31aae242b3811221437ed6d780c0c05f643675cf3ebe097d786b998
confirmations
289450
spent
true